gpt4 book ai didi

compilation - 使用 Rakudo Star : Can't install on OS X 编写 perl6 程序

转载 作者:行者123 更新时间:2023-12-01 07:47:19 25 4
gpt4 key购买 nike

我正在尝试在 OS X 10.6 上安装 Rakudo Star,但我已经到了总是令人沮丧的地方,我的构建失败了,我不知道如何继续。这里有没有人知道过去的方法? (我正在尝试将其设置为编写一些本地 perl6 程序,所以我不确定规则是否需要在服务器故障或堆栈溢出上这样做,如有必要请打我)

我已经下载了提供的发行版并运行了

制作版本=2010.07

成功创建 实际文件夹中的分布

rakudo-star-2010.07

对于任何感兴趣的人,我需要获取 gnu find 的端口版本(安装到/opt/local/bin/gfind),然后将我的常规 find 别名为 gfind。 OS X 发现缺少 -printf 选项。

顺便说一句,根据 READ me,我

$ cd rakudo-star-2010.07
$ perl Configure.pl --gen-parrot

这会持续一段时间,但随后会出现以下情况

/Users/alanstorm/Downloads/rakudo-star-7652a0b/rakudo-star-2010.07/install/src/parrot/2.​​6.0/pmc/timer.dump
/Users/alanstorm/Downloads/rakudo-star-7652a0b/rakudo-star-2010.07/install/src/parrot/2.​​6.0/pmc/undef.dump
/Users/alanstorm/Downloads/rakudo-star-7652a0b/rakudo-star-2010.07/install/src/parrot/2.​​6.0/pmc/unmanagedstruct.dump
/Users/alanstorm/Downloads/rakudo-star-7652a0b/rakudo-star-2010.07/install/src/parrot/2.​​6.0/vtable.dump
完成 install_dev_files.pl

从 install/bin/parrot_config 读取配置信息...
===对不起!===
需要 Parrot 修订版 r48225(当前为 r0)
自动构建随附的 Parrot 版本
distribution(),尝试重新运行Configure.pl
'--gen-parrot' 选项。或者,使用“--parrot-config”选项来
明确指定要用于的 parrot_config 的位置
建立乐堂之星。

我在这些 IRC 日志中发现了一个类似的问题:http://irclog.perlgeek.de/parrot/2009-05-11但我对项目(或 git)的了解不够深入,无法理解他们为解决这个问题所做的工作。我最好的猜测是,似乎应该将颠覆修订号写入 parrot_config(这是一个二进制文件),并且因为最初的 make(似乎)使用 git 来获取文件,这并没有发生。

此外,在 perl 配置失败后,我确实有两个名为 parrot_config 的新文件。

找 。 -name parrot_config
./install/bin/parrot_config
./parrot-2.6.0/parrot_config

我尝试使用以下标志运行 Configure.pl,但每个标志都以上述相同的“抱歉”消息结束?

perl Configure.pl --gen-parrot --parrot-config install/bin/parrot_config
perl Configure.pl install/bin/parrot_config
perl Configure.pl --gen-parrot --parrot-config parrot-2.6.0/parrot_config
perl Configure.pl --parrot-config parrot-2.6.0/parrot_config

这里有人对下一步有什么想法吗?如果答案是“询问 perl 人员”,那么您对最好的地方有什么建议吗?

最佳答案

您永远不必运行 make VERSION=2010.07完全 - 这是发布经理的工作。

相反,您应该下载 make VERSION=2010.07 的 tarball。应该创建(但目前似乎不适用于除 linux 之外的任何平台)。

这是正确的链接:http://github.com/downloads/rakudo/star/rakudo-star-2010.07.tar.gz

抱歉造成困惑,我们仍在努力更好地记录这一点。

关于compilation - 使用 Rakudo Star : Can't install on OS X 编写 perl6 程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3383339/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com